Government Accountability Nonprofit Seeks Executive Director to Lead Dynamic Team

Campaign for Accountability (CfA), a non-profit government watchdog organization focused on public accountability, is seeking an executive director to oversee the organization’s day to day activities.

Campaign for Accountability

CfA is a small nonprofit dedicated to uncovering ethical problems and malfeasance in public life.  CfA investigates federal and state officials, corporate malfeasance, and, through the Tech Transparency Project, large technology companies. The Ideal Candidate

This position is a unique opportunity for an experienced lawyer or policy expert to oversee CfA’s accountability efforts. The executive director oversees CfA’s legal actions, press communications, administrative functions, and interactions with outside organizations.  The ideal candidate will either be an attorney or have deep familiarity with the law and is comfortable speaking with media. CfA seeks candidates with experience in some combination of technology policy, ethics issues, and government transparency, as well as experience making open records requests, knowledge of federal ethics laws, and familiarity with lobbying and campaign finance regulations.

This position is (or will be post-Covid) located in Washington, DC.

Essential Responsibilities

  • Draft CfA’s core products, including:
    •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) requests;
    • State open records requests;
    • Requests for investigations;
    • Letters to federal officials;
    • Investigative reports;
    • Op eds.
  • Supervise all of CfA’s written materials, including website content, press releases, newsletters, social media posts, and communications with CfA’s donors.
  • Manage CfA’s litigation and review work of outside counsel.
  • Serve as CfA’s primary spokesperson to media outlets and maintain relationships with journalists.
  • Conceive of and manage the execution of long-term research projects to investigate new areas of unethical conduct.
  • Oversee all financial, operational, and administrative functions, working in tandem with CfA’s CFO.
  • Represent CfA in all external relationships including with partner organizations, investigators, legislators, and supporters.
  • Monitor news developments and conduct research to spot potential legal actions.
  • Manage CfA’s staff and hire new employees when positions become vacant.

 

Qualifications

  • 7 years of experience working in government, advocacy, journalism, or politics.
  • Experience managing a team of individuals.
  • Law degree or experience and familiarity with open records laws.
  • Familiarity with regulatory environment pertaining to technology companies.
  • Proven track record of conceiving and executing creative investigative strategies.
  • Strong organizational and project-management abilities.
  • Exceptional writing, research, and verbal communications skills.
  • High degree of professional ethics and integrity.
  • Instinct to cooperate and work with others.
